Ivory Coast U20 Beats Ghana U20 2-1 in Friendly Match

In an electrifying World Friendly International match, Ghana U20 faced off against Ivory Coast U20 in a gripping encounter that saw the Young Elephants edge out the Black Satellites 2-1. First Half Fireworks: A Fast Start

Football fans were treated to early excitement just two minutes into the first half when Tsivanyo B. of Ghana U20 made a blazing start by netting the opener. The Black Satellites looked strong, pressing high and controlling the tempo.

However, the Ivorian U20 team wasn’t to be outshone. In the 12th minute, a composed Bamba G. slotted home an equalizer from the penalty spot. His calmness under pressure brought the game to a 1-1 stalemate, leaving fans on edge throughout the remainder of the half.

Second Half: Ivory Coast Take Control

Coming into the second half, Ivory Coast U20 showed tactical discipline and stronger midfield dominance. Their persistence paid off in the 69th minute when Yaya Tape K. scored a well-placed goal that would eventually seal the victory.

Despite Ghana’s attempts to level the score, Ivory Coast maintained their defensive structure and saw the match out confidently.

Standout Players

  • Tsivanyo B. (Ghana U20) – Showed clinical finishing early on.
  • Bamba G. (Ivory Coast U20) – Calm and calculated under pressure.
  • Yaya Tape K. (Ivory Coast U20) – Provided the winning edge with a composed finish.
